Before the clock starts: "work" means three different things
Every page that answers this question with one number is quietly choosing one definition of working and hiding the other two. The research actually runs on three clocks:
- The chemistry clock. How fast the compound raises choline in blood. Measured in minutes, in pharmacokinetic studies.
- The acute-trial clock. What a single dose changed on a test given the same day: cognitive scores, hormone levels, jump power. Measured 60 to 120 minutes after ingestion, because that is when researchers scheduled the tests.
- The calendar clock. What daily dosing changed over days, weeks, or months. The shortest window with a positive result is 6 days; the classic clinical trials ran 90 to 180 days.

How long does alpha-GPC take to kick in?
The number most pages quote here, a choline peak inside half an hour, is real but borrowed from the wrong route. In a 1992 randomized study of 12 volunteers, a single 1,000 mg dose of alpha-GPC raised free plasma choline rapidly, peaking at 15 to 30 minutes (PMID 1428296). That dose was intramuscular: injected, not swallowed. A capsule has to survive digestion first, so that curve is not your capsule's curve, and any page quoting it as oral onset is misreading the study.
What the oral record supports is more modest. Small human crossover studies show single oral doses raise plasma choline, at 480 mg (PMID 38490741, human RCT, 12 men) and at 550 mg of choline equivalents (PMID 34287673, human RCT, 6 men), but neither entry in our dataset carries a clean oral time-to-peak figure, so we will not invent one.
What acute oral trials measured, and when
Researchers running single-dose trials had to pick a testing window, and they converged on the first two hours:
- 60 minutes: in a 2024 randomized double-blind crossover of 20 resistance-trained men, single oral doses of 630 mg or 315 mg improved Stroop test scores versus placebo 60 minutes after ingestion, while Flanker and N-Back tests, jumps, bench press throws and growth hormone did not move (human RCT).
- 60 and 120 minutes: in a randomized crossover of 8 healthy young men, a single 1,000 mg oral dose raised plasma growth hormone at 60 minutes and raised free fatty acids and ketone bodies at 120 minutes (human RCT, very small sample). A 1992 hormone-challenge study also reported alpha-GPC potentiated the growth hormone response to GHRH, more so in older adults (PMID 1577400, non-randomized trial).
- 90 minutes: a blend containing 500 mg alpha-GPC taken 90 minutes before testing changed nothing versus placebo: no jump, bench press or cognition difference in 20 trained men (PMID 28222577, human RCT, blend design).
So the defensible acute statement is narrow: oral trials that found anything found it at the 60-minute mark, on specific instruments, at specific doses, and other instruments in the same trials stayed flat. The measured timeline, minute by minute, week by week
Here is the whole record on one axis. Every row is something a study measured at that timepoint, with its evidence level attached. Nothing here is a promise of what you will notice; it is what instruments recorded.
| Time mark | What a study measured there | PMID | Evidence level |
|---|---|---|---|
| 15-30 min | Free plasma choline peaked after 1,000 mg injected (intramuscular, not oral) | 1428296 | Human RCT, 12 volunteers |
| 60 min | Stroop score improved after one oral 630 mg or 315 mg dose; Flanker, N-Back, jumps and growth hormone unchanged | 39683633 | Human RCT crossover, 20 men |
| 60 min | Plasma growth hormone rose after one oral 1,000 mg dose | 22673596 | Human RCT crossover, 8 men |
| 120 min | Free fatty acids and ketone bodies (fat-oxidation markers) rose in the same trial | 22673596 | Human RCT crossover, 8 men |
| 90 min pre-test | Blend holding 500 mg alpha-GPC: no jump, bench press or cognition change | 28222577 | Human RCT crossover, 20 men |
| Day 6 | Lower-body isometric peak force rose on 600 mg per day | 26582972 | Human RCT crossover, 13 men |
| Day 7 | 250 mg per day improved jump velocity and power; no isometric strength or vigilance change at any dose | 29042830 | Human RCT, 48 men |
| Week 2 | Self-rated motivation at night higher; anxiety unchanged | 34207484 | Single-blind trial, 39 volunteers |
| Week 12 | ADAS-cog improved versus placebo in adults with amnestic mild cognitive impairment, 600 mg per day | 39300341 | Human RCT, 100 adults |
| Day 90 | Symptom scales improved in vascular dementia patients on 1 g per day injected, versus citicoline; no placebo arm | 1916007 | Open randomized trial, 120 patients |
| Day 180 | ADAS-Cog improved while the placebo group worsened, in Alzheimer's patients on 1,200 mg per day | 12637119 | Human RCT, 261 patients |
If a page promises a felt effect at an exact minute mark, it is quoting nobody. The measured record: injected choline chemistry moves within 30 minutes, oral acute trials tested at 60 to 120 minutes and found instrument changes there, the earliest multi-day change came at day 6, and clinical trials scored patients at 12 weeks and beyond.
How long for alpha-GPC to work? The multi-week record
The shortest daily-dosing window with a positive result is six days. In a double-blind crossover of 13 college-aged men, 600 mg per day for 6 days increased lower-body isometric peak force versus placebo (a change of +98.8 N against -39.0 N on placebo), while the upper-body test trended without reaching significance. Thirteen people is a very small base for any conclusion, which is exactly how the authors framed it (human RCT).
A 7-day randomized trial in 48 healthy men complicates the picture in a useful way: no isometric strength or psychomotor vigilance differences at 500 mg or 250 mg versus caffeine or placebo, improved jump velocity and power at 250 mg only, and significantly depressed thyroid-stimulating hormone at 500 mg (PMID 29042830, human RCT). Same week-scale window, mostly flat results, plus a hormone signal worth knowing about.
The longer clinical windows come from patient research, reported here as research history, not as anything a supplement treats. A 2024 randomized placebo-controlled trial in 100 Korean adults with amnestic mild cognitive impairment measured a significantly better ADAS-cog score after 12 weeks of 600 mg per day (human RCT). The prescription-era trials ran longer still: 90 days in a 120-patient vascular dementia comparison (PMID 1916007, open randomized, no placebo) and 180 days in the 261-patient Alzheimer's trial, where ADAS-Cog improved 3.20 points while the placebo group worsened 2.90 (PMID 12637119, human RCT).
Notice what is missing: nobody measured week-to-week onset curves. Between day 7 and week 12 the record is nearly empty, so any claim about what happens at week 3 or week 6 is interpolation, not data.
How does alpha-GPC make you feel?
The honest answer: the trials cannot tell you, because they did not ask. The instruments in the studies above are Stroop and Flanker scores, reaction times, mid-thigh pulls, jump plates, blood draws and clinician-scored cognitive scales. An instrument moving is not a sensation, and none of these trials measured a felt onset, a buzz, or a mood lift on dosing day.
Exactly one study in our dataset asked people how they felt over time: a single-blind placebo-controlled trial in 39 healthy volunteers who self-rated emotions for two weeks. The alpha-GPC group reported higher motivation at night, with no effect on anxiety (PMID 34207484, single-blind, so weaker than a double-blind design). That is the entire published record of alpha-GPC and subjective experience.
Two anchors keep expectations realistic. First, alpha-GPC is a choline compound, a precursor the body uses to make acetylcholine and cell-membrane phospholipids; the acetylcholine-release mechanism comes from rat studies (PMID 1662399, animal evidence), not human ones. It is not a stimulant, and in the 7-day trial that included a 200 mg caffeine arm, no group separated on psychomotor vigilance (PMID 29042830, human RCT). How long does alpha-GPC last?
Measured duration is the thinnest part of this entire literature, so here is the record without decoration. Acute human trials stopped measuring at about the two-hour mark: the 1,000 mg growth hormone study took its last readings at 120 minutes, where fat-oxidation markers were still elevated (PMID 22673596, human RCT). Past two hours, single-dose human data in our dataset simply ends. Nobody followed a dose to see when its measured effects faded.
Animal work hints longer but cannot be converted into a human schedule: in rats, oral alpha-GPC reversed a chemically induced memory deficit with effects lasting up to 30 hours, at 600 mg per kilogram, a dose far beyond any human label (PMID 1662399, animal study). And after a full course rather than a single dose, one open-label study of 50 elderly patients reported psychometric improvements that partially persisted 7 to 9 months after a 3-month course ended (PMID 29927403, uncontrolled, so no placebo comparison). Interesting, weak, and honestly labeled as both.
How long does alpha-GPC stay in your system?
Here is where we break with most pages on this topic: our 144-study dataset contains no human elimination half-life for supplemental alpha-GPC, so we will not quote one. The human pharmacokinetic work that exists is mostly formulation science, like the crossover showing a 1,200 mg tablet was bioequivalent to the reference capsule on total exposure and peak concentration (PMID 31040642, human RCT), which confirms absorption but never hands the shopper a simple hours-in-your-body number.
The deeper reason no clean number exists is that the question is slightly wrong. Radiolabelled tracer work in rats shows alpha-GPC is hydrolyzed in the gut lining during absorption, splitting into choline and glycerophosphate; the labelled metabolites spread through liver, kidney, lung, spleen and brain, choline was incorporated into brain phospholipids within 24 hours, and most of the label was eventually exhaled as carbon dioxide (PMID 8243501, animal study). In other words, it stops being alpha-GPC almost immediately and becomes part of the body's choline pool: some builds into cell membranes, some is metabolized away. Asking how long it stays in your system is like asking how long dinner stays in your system; the molecule dissolves into ordinary biochemistry rather than waiting around to be cleared.
One metabolite deserves its own mention: like other water-soluble choline forms, oral GPC raised TMAO, a gut-microbiome byproduct under active cardiovascular research, in a small human crossover (PMID 34287673, human RCT, 6 men), while a separate single 480 mg dose study measured no significant TMAO rise (PMID 38490741, human RCT). Both findings are reported in full in the research library.
One safety note before you plan a timeline
Anyone thinking in months should know the two largest safety datasets, which point in opposite directions. A Korean national cohort of 12 million adults found prescription alpha-GPC users had a 43 to 46 percent higher 10-year stroke risk, rising with longer use, though as observational data it cannot rule out confounding by indication (PMID 34817582, observational). A 2025 cohort of 508,107 patients with mild cognitive impairment found users had lower dementia conversion and lower stroke risk among those who did not progress, and did not reproduce the harm signal in key groups (PMID 40155153, observational). Frequently asked questions
How long does alpha-GPC take to work?
There is no single answer, because trials measured different outcomes on different clocks. Acute studies recorded a Stroop test change and a growth hormone rise 60 minutes after one oral dose, a strength change appeared after 6 days of daily dosing, and clinical trials in older adults measured cognitive scores at 12 weeks to 180 days. Pick the outcome you care about, then use its clock.
How long does alpha-GPC take to kick in?
If kick in means blood chemistry: an injected 1,000 mg dose peaked free plasma choline at 15 to 30 minutes in a 12-person study, and single oral doses raised plasma choline in small human trials that did not publish a time to peak. If kick in means something you notice, no study measured a felt onset, so any exact minute count you read online is an invention.
How does alpha-GPC make you feel?
The honest answer is that the research cannot say, because trials measured instruments, not feelings: Stroop scores, reaction time, jump power, hormone levels. The one self-report study, a single-blind trial in 39 healthy volunteers, found higher self-rated motivation at night over two weeks and no change in anxiety. Alpha-GPC is a choline compound, not a stimulant, so descriptions of a caffeine-like buzz are community lore, not trial data.
How long does alpha-GPC last?
Acute human trials only measured out to about 120 minutes after a dose, where a 1,000 mg dose still showed raised fat-oxidation markers. Beyond two hours, single-dose human data in our dataset simply stops. A rat study reported behavioral effects lasting up to 30 hours, but that was an animal experiment at doses far above human label servings, so treat it as mechanism evidence, not a schedule.
How long does alpha-GPC stay in your system?
No human elimination half-life exists in our 144-study dataset, so we will not quote one. Animal tracer work shows alpha-GPC is broken down during absorption into choline and glycerophosphate, the choline joins the body's choline pool, some is built into cell membranes (reaching brain phospholipids within 24 hours in rats), and much of the rest is eventually metabolized and exhaled. It stops being alpha-GPC almost immediately.
How long before a workout should I take alpha-GPC?
The trials did not converge on one window. Studies that found acute effects measured them 60 minutes after ingestion, one null trial dosed a blend 90 minutes before testing, and the strength trial that did find a difference used 6 days of daily 600 mg dosing rather than a single pre-workout serving.
